Particle production in Pb-Pb collisions at 2.76 TeV is studied in the
(3+1)-dimensional viscous hydrodynamic model. The shapes of the calculated
transverse momentum spectra of pions, kaons, protons, Xis, and Omegas are in
satisfactory agreement with preliminary data of the ALICE Collaboration, while
the particle ratio proton/pion is slightly overpredicted.
